Installation Procedure
1. |
Install the BPMV insulators
(1) to the BPMV bracket (3). |
3. |
Install the 3 BMPV bracket
bolts (4) and tighten to 10 N·m (89 lb in)
. |
4. |
Install the BPMV bracket
assembly (1). |
5. |
Install the 2 BPMV bracket
bolts (2) and tighten to 20 N·m (15 lb ft)
. |
6. |
Install the 6 brake pipes (1,
2) to the BPMV and tighten to 18 N·m (13 lb
ft) . |
7. |
Connect the electrical
connector to the EBCM/EBTCM. |
8. |
Remove the CH-558-10
cap (1) and install the brake fluid reservoir cap.
|
9. |
Install the radiator surge
tank (1). |
10. |
Install the radiator surge
tank clip (2). |
|
Caution: When adding fluid to the brake fluid reservoir or to the
clutch fluid reservoir, use only DOT-4+ brake fluid from a clean,
sealed container. This polyglycol brake fluid is hygroscopic and
absorbs moisture. Do not use fluid from an open container that may
be contaminated with water. Improper or contaminated fluid could
result in damage to the system components. |
